During the marked dry season in Gashaka-Gumti National Park, permanent rivers, hippo pools and remaining waterholes become focal points where elephants, buffalo, antelopes, hippos and large primate groups (including Nigeria-Cameroon chimpanzees) concentrate.
This seasonal congregation improves visibility for wildlife viewing but is sensitive to river flow and local human activity.
